We were looking for a Mediterranean spot near us via Google maps search and I was surprised that I never noticed this spot before (we come to the Sprouts next door on occasion). So, the place doesn't stand out, but the reviews seemed reasonable, so off we went. Wow! The food presentation alone put a smile on my face (pic is after I had eaten some already). Happy to say that everything tasted just as wonderful - fresh, light, tasty. My husband was impressed with the tenderness and flavor of both the chicken and beef. He had the beef kabob with humus, for our 3 year old I ordered the kids chicken kebab with rice (thumbs up for having a kid's menu!), and I had one of their specials - lentil fried rice sans meat. Apart from the food, the owner (I believe) who took our order and the cook who also served us were great. Neither overly friendly or impatient, they were a pleasure to be serviced by. They look you in the eye when speaking, are accommodating, polite, professional. Makes a difference, big time. All that to say that this hole-in-the-wall restaurant has made it to our go-to list. We'll be back agin and again as long as they're here.

Today is third visit. Tried the scratch made lentil soup (everything is scratch made except the grape leaves)..Super delicious. Also am trying the shawarma quesadilla and man is it good!! I got my usual drink, the Armenian coffee. Everything here is excellent. Tony the owner is outstanding!! I’m losing track of the number of my visits to this excellent restaurant. Today I’m having a delicious salmon kabab + kale salad + terragon soda! The photo I took isn’t the best and I should have shot it before I polished off most of the salmon. Thank you, Tony! 👍🏼🏁🍻 Today’s lunch in second photo. That’s a house salad with the delicious buttermilk vinaigrette, and a chicken kebab on a bed of the Lentil Fried Rice.

I really liked this place. Good menu, lots of variety. We were served by Mike, a very polite, pleasant man. We took a plate with beef and a chicken wrap. The meat is very tasty and the beef and chicken are very juicy, the salad is fresh crispy and the hummus is delicious. A small room, and a few places to sit outside, first you make an order, then they bring you food in disposable dishes. We ate everything in 5 minutes because the food was so delicious. I definitely want to come again
